Rookie Colt Keith Emerges as Key Player, Leading Detroit Tigers to Victory

In a thrilling game against the Los Angeles Dodgers, Detroit Tigers rookie Colt Keith showcased his immense potential, proving himself as a vital asset to the team. The Tigers trailed by five runs entering the ninth inning, and fans were already making their way to the exits. However, a remarkable comeback led by Keith's heroics and clutch plays turned the tide in favor of Detroit.
Keith's journey to the big leagues has been one of steady growth and development. Considered one of the biggest stories of spring training, he signed a significant contract without having yet experienced an MLB at-bat. As a quiet and introspective player, Keith absorbed knowledge and honed his skills, thriving under the mentorship of Tigers legend Alan Trammell. The hard work paid off as Keith seamlessly transitioned to second base and began to make his mark on the field.
During the critical ninth inning against the Dodgers, Keith came to the plate with two outs and a runner on base. He had studied the scouting report, knowing that reliever Evan Phillips favored throwing first-pitch cutters to left-handed batters. Keith confidently declared to hitting coach Michael Brdar that he would pull the upcoming pitch. True to his word, he connected with the cutter, sending the ball sailing over the outstretched glove of Teoscar Hernández at the right-field wall for a game-changing home run, tying the score.
Teammates and coaches have taken notice of Keith's remarkable growth. Tigers shortstop Zach McKinstry commended him for his positive approach and ability to capitalize on good pitches. In the top of the 10th inning, with the bases loaded and the dangerous Freddie Freeman at the plate, Keith made a pivotal defensive play. McKinstry directed him to cover second base, and when Freeman hit a ground ball just to his glove side, Keith executed a swift exchange and fired a precise throw to first, resulting in a double play that ended the inning.
Keith's defensive skills have faced scrutiny this season, particularly his slow-handedness on double-play turns and minus-10 defensive runs saved at second base. However, his quick decision-making and accurate throw in the face of pressure showed the immense potential he possesses.
The game reached its climax in the bottom of the 10th inning when Gio Urshela crushed a walk-off home run, securing the Tigers an 11-9 victory. This win marked the team's eighth triumph in their past 12 games, signifying a resurgence for a team that was once struggling.
Keith's impact on the Tigers' resurgence cannot be overstated. Over his past 27 games, he boasts an impressive batting average of .327, including seven home runs. He has also reached base in 13 consecutive contests. Since May 11, Keith leads all MLB rookies with an outstanding .509 slugging percentage.
Tigers manager A.J. Hinch lauds Keith's mental and physical fortitude, emphasizing his belief in his own abilities and his determination to prove himself to his teammates, fans, and even to himself. Keith's first month in the league was challenging, with a batting average of just .152 and a lack of power. However, he made key adjustments, including deleting social media, adopting a subtle toe tap in his swing, and referring to goals he had written down before the season.
Off the field, Keith faced the struggles of adapting to life as a professional athlete, navigating the dynamics of the clubhouse, and finding his place among his more experienced teammates. However, as his on-field performance flourished, Keith gained confidence, showing a more comfortable and exuberant side to his personality.
